Market Segmentation

The safety and process filter market can be segmented based on type, application, and end-user industry. By type, the market includes air filters, liquid filters, gas filters, and multi-media filters. Air filters are widely used in HVAC systems and industrial ventilation, while liquid filters are essential in water treatment, chemical processing, and oil refining. Gas filters are used to purify gases in industrial and laboratory settings, ensuring safe handling and optimal performance. Multi-media filters, incorporating multiple layers of filtration media, provide enhanced contaminant removal in both air and liquid applications.

By application, the market is divided into industrial manufacturing, chemical processing, pharmaceuticals, food and beverage, power generation, and oil and gas. Industrial manufacturing and chemical processing sectors are the largest consumers due to the need for maintaining equipment efficiency and product quality. Pharmaceuticals and food industries are increasingly adopting process filters to meet stringent hygiene and safety standards. Power generation and oil and gas industries rely on safety filters to protect machinery and ensure operational continuity.

Technological Advancements

Innovation in filter media and design is a key factor shaping the safety and process filter market. Manufacturers are developing filters with higher efficiency, longer lifespan, and lower energy consumption. Advanced materials such as nanofibers, activated carbon composites, and pleated synthetic media are improving filtration performance while reducing maintenance costs. Smart filters equipped with sensors and monitoring systems are gaining traction, enabling real-time performance tracking and predictive maintenance. This technological evolution not only enhances safety but also optimizes operational efficiency, making filters an integral part of modern industrial systems.

Challenges in the Market

Despite its growth, the safety and process filter market faces certain challenges. High initial investment costs for advanced filtration systems can deter small and medium-sized enterprises from adoption. Additionally, frequent replacement and maintenance requirements add to operational expenses. The presence of counterfeit or low-quality filters in the market also poses risks to both equipment and personnel. Furthermore, industries must constantly keep up with evolving regulatory standards, which can vary across regions, making compliance complex and sometimes costly.
